Republicans recover over 100 files deleted by Jan. 6 committee days before GOP took majority: Report

Forensic investigators hired by a Republican-led committee recovered more than encrypted 100 files that the Democratic-led House Jan. 6 Select Committee deleted more than days before the GOP took over the House majority, according to a new report released Monday.

House Administration Oversight Subcommittee Chair Barry Loudermilk, R-Ga., sent a letter to former Select Committee Chair Bennie Thompson, D-Miss., demanding he provide answers and passwords for the data, which was deleted against House rules, according to Fox News Digital.

The subcommittee hired a digital forensics team to determine what information was not handed over, and the team discovered 117 files that were encrypted and deleted on Jan. 1, 2023, two days before Republicans were sworn into the majority, according to the report.

Loudermilk said in his letter to Thompson that the Mississippi Democrat acknowledged over the summer that the select committee “did not archive all Committee records as required by House Rules” and had “sent specific transcribed interviews and depositions to the White House and Department of Homeland Security but did not archive them with the Clerk of the House.”

One recovered file detailed an individual whose testimony was not archived, but “most of the recovered files are password-protected, preventing us from determining what they contain,” Loudermilk also said.

The Georgia Republican is demanding Thompson provide a “list of passwords” for all select committee files. He also wrote letters to the White House and Homeland Security Department asking for “unedited and unredacted transcripts” of testimony from their officials before the former select committee.
